WebIn the step: copy /b 7zS.sfx + config.txt + archive.7z archive.exe. the archive.7z file is the 7-zip archive that contains all your files. This should be the last step. Before this step, archive.7z should be created, containing setup.exe and any other files it needs. Create this using: 7z a archive.7z setup.exe. Share. WebDec 30, 2024 · The eventlog is stating that shutdown.exe was initiated, so the task is to find out what program called shutdown.exe. Since it was on behalf of NT AUTHORITY\SYSTEM, then a process running under the user "NT AUTHORITY\SYSTEM" should be the guilty process. Process Explorer can be used to see all processes running under that user. WebDec 20, 2024 · Add a comment. 2. Your observation is right. The .exe file of a .NET core app is only a stub loader. WebJul 25, 2013 · python.exe -m pip install cx-Freeze. Tip: If you want to run the Python command from the terminal without having to navigate to the installation folder, it is recommended that you add your Python directory to the Windows Path. Click here for information on how this is done. 3. Verify Installation.
